From 7952f847fbe8f506106587785fc097467f4b1801 Mon Sep 17 00:00:00 2001
From: mac <user@users-MacBook-Pro.local>
Date: 星期三, 27 九月 2023 11:52:31 +0800
Subject: [PATCH] 2023年09月27日11:52:00

---
 HDL_ON/UI/UI2/3-Intelligence/Automation/LogicMethod.cs |   13 ++++++++++---
 1 files changed, 10 insertions(+), 3 deletions(-)

diff --git a/HDL_ON/UI/UI2/3-Intelligence/Automation/LogicMethod.cs b/HDL_ON/UI/UI2/3-Intelligence/Automation/LogicMethod.cs
index 3031525..fd883fb 100644
--- a/HDL_ON/UI/UI2/3-Intelligence/Automation/LogicMethod.cs
+++ b/HDL_ON/UI/UI2/3-Intelligence/Automation/LogicMethod.cs
@@ -189,7 +189,7 @@
             list.AddRange(list2);
             list.AddRange(FunctionList.List.groupControls);
 #if DEBUG
-            GetTestDevice(ref list, true);
+            //GetTestDevice(ref list, true);
 #endif
             return list;
         }
@@ -371,7 +371,9 @@
                 return "FunctionIcon/DoorLock/DoorLock.png";
             }
             else if (SPK.SensorDryContact == device.spk
-                || SPK.SensorDryContact2 == device.spk)
+                || SPK.SensorDryContact2 == device.spk
+                || SPK.OtherCommon == device.spk
+                )
             {
                 return "LogicIcon/ganjiedian.png";
             }
@@ -382,7 +384,7 @@
             //LogicIcon/heatlogic.png"
             return $"FunctionIcon/Icon/{device.IconName}.png";
 
-        }
+    }
         /// <summary>
         /// 鑾峰彇璁惧绫诲瀷鍥炬爣(宸插純鐢� 2022骞�11鏈�25鏃�14:07:30)
         /// </summary>
@@ -527,6 +529,7 @@
             || device.spk == SPK.LightCCT
             || device.spk == SPK.LightRGB
             || device.spk == SPK.LightRGBW
+            || device.spk == SPK.OtherCommon
             );
             if (lightjosn != null)
             {
@@ -660,6 +663,7 @@
                 functionTypeList.Add(SPK.AirSwitch);
                 functionTypeList.Add(SPK.PanelSocket);
                 functionTypeList.Add(SPK.ElectricSocket);
+                functionTypeList.Add(SPK.OtherCommon);
             }
             //缇ゆ帶
             else if (deviceType == Language.StringByID(StringId.GroupControl))
@@ -824,6 +828,7 @@
                 functionTypeList.Add(SPK.SensorPirHold);
                 functionTypeList.Add(SPK.ElectricalTvHisense);
                 functionTypeList.Add(SPK.SensorLight);
+                functionTypeList.Add(SPK.OtherCommon);
 
             }
 
@@ -915,6 +920,7 @@
                         deviceTypeList.Add(SPK.MechanicalArm);
                         deviceTypeList.Add(SPK.AcIr);
                         deviceTypeList.Add(SPK.ElectricalTvHisense);
+                        deviceTypeList.Add(SPK.OtherCommon);
                     }
                     break;
             }
@@ -1233,6 +1239,7 @@
                  new Entity.Function { sid = "1234567890", name = "鍏夌収浼犳劅鍣�", spk = Entity.SPK.SensorLight },
                   new Entity.Function { sid = "1234567891", name = "骞茶妭鐐�", spk = Entity.SPK.SensorDryContact },
                    new Entity.Function { sid = "1234567892", name = "绱ф�ユ眰鍔╀紶鎰熷櫒", spk = Entity.SPK.SensorHelp },
+                        new Entity.Function { sid = "12345678921", name = "閫氱敤寮�鍏�", spk = Entity.SPK.OtherCommon },
                     //new Entity.Function { sid = "12345678933456", name = "闂ㄩ攣", spk = Entity.SPK.DoorLock },
                     //  new Entity.Function { sid = "1234567895444", name = "瑙嗛闂ㄩ攣", spk = Entity.SPK.VideoDoorLock },
                       //new Entity.Function { sid = "12345678968888", name = "浜轰綋瀛樺湪浼犳劅鍣�", spk = Entity.SPK.SensorPirHold },

--
Gitblit v1.8.0